For my how-to speeches in college, I did how to change a tire and how to make an origami swan. The origami swan was cool because I passed out origami paper to the class and had them follow along with me as I made a humoungous origami swan out of butcher paper.
(And I did my informative speech on dust. It was actually very interesting.)
I'd suggest you do your how-to on something that you already know "how-to" do. That makes it a lot easier. Or maybe something you are very interested in learning how to do so that you will be motivated to research and then write a humourous speech. Also, telling how to do something everybody already knows, like brushing your teeth, can easily be done humourously.
